Steven Reid has announced he has left his role as first-team coach at Nottingham Forest. The former Republic of Ireland international has announced his departure on social media.

 

His departure ends a lengthy association with the club which included securing promotion to the Premier League. Reid wrote on Instagram: “So my time at @officialnffc has come to an end. Would like to wish everybody at the club every success for the future. Some amazing memories shared over 3 seasons that will live with me forever.

”Reid returned to the City Ground ahead of the 2023/24 campaign after departing the previous summer following a two-year spell with the Reds. When he left in 2022, on the back of promotion being secured, he said he wanted to take up a new challenge and planned to offer his services as a specialist coach “helping people improve their mental well-being, confidence, and leadershipReid first joined Forest as part of Chris Hughton’s coaching staff in October 2020.
